South Florida athletes sign Letters of Intent

Today is National Signing Day for graduating High school seniors when they finally make written commitments to colleges and universities who have been recruiting them throughout the past season.

Here is a breakdown of some of the athletes in South Florida and Miami-Dade County:

  • Matthew Thomas, OLB, Miami Booker T. Washington H.S. has committed to Florida State
  • Denver Kirkland, OL, Miami Booker T. Washington H.S. has committed to the University of Arkansas
  • Joey Bosa, DT, Ft. Lauderdale St. Thomas Aquinas H.S. has committed to Ohio State University
  • Artie Burns, CB, Miami Northwestern H.S. has committed to the University of Miami
  • Jamal Carter, S, Miami Southridge H.S. has committed to the University of Miami
  • Greg Bryant, RB, Delray Beach American Heritage School has committed to the University of Notre Dame
  • Paul James III, DE, Miami Norland has committed to the University of Illinois
  • Alex Collins, RB, South Plantation H.S. has committed to the University of Arkansas

Jermaine Grace, OLB, Miramar; Adrian Baker, ATH, Hollywood-Chaminade Prep; Keith Bryant, DT, Delray Beach Atlantic have yet to make an announcement but a follow-up on their signings will come later today.
